A natural extension of superadditivity is not sufficient to imply that the
grand coalition is efficient when externalities are present. We provide a condition, analogous to convexity, that is sufficient for the grand coalition to be
efficient and show that this also implies that the (appropriately de…fined) core is
nonempty. Moreover, we propose a mechanism which implements the most efficient partition for all coalition formation games and characterize the resulting
payoff division.
